My port deck was ripped in two when I disassembled my boat that the previous owner bedded down with 5200. I went throught alot of "so called" 5200 solvent. It might work in small applications but cannot migrate to the center of the beam sockets. I was very careful and was sucessful with 3 of the 4 attachment points, but the last one, not so good. It tore a about 8- 10 inches of deck and I am still having trouble getting it solid. As far as I am concerned 5200 is permanent, If I "might" need to get it apart I use something else.
